About this property

Flint Cottage is full of traditional character. Entering through the welcoming hallway featuring exposed beams, you are introduced to a versatile floorplan designed for comfortable living. The heart of the home is the expansive kitchen, bathed in natural light from overhead skylights. This space flows effortlessly into a bright, airy garden room boasting large windows with delightful views of the greenery and ample built-in wooden storage wardrobes. For formal hosting, and a separate dining room accessible via elegant double doors. The living spaces continue to impress with a generous, dual-aspect lounge anchored by a classic brick fireplace with a wood-burning stove and double French doors opening out to the garden area. Tucked away for privacy, a dedicated study with built-in wood-toned storage cabinets provides an ideal, quiet home office setup. Practicality is well-catered for across the ground floor, featuring a functional utility room with side garden access, storage cupboards, and a dedicated sink area, alongside a conveniently located downstairs cloakroom fitted with a toilet and compact washbasin.

Moving up to the first floor, a central landing connects three well-proportioned bedrooms. The principal suite is a generous double room complete with extensive built-in wooden wardrobes and direct access to its own private facilities. Across the landing, the second bedroom offers another spacious double room featuring a large, recessed storage cupboard with open shelving, while the third bedroom is a comfortable space benefiting from double built-in louvred wardrobes.

Outside

A gravel and concrete driveway provides convenient off-road parking and grants access to a detached outbuilding block comprising a covered car port and an adjoining enclosed storeroom. Transitioning around to the rear, the house reveals a painted or rendered two-story rear elevation featuring multi-pane first-floor windows, a ground-floor utility door, and dark-timber French doors fitted with a small timber gate. Extending from this main block is a generous single-story garden room extension equipped with three skylights and a wide expanse of dark-framed windows that look out across a paved patio area. This patio opens onto an expansive, fully enclosed lawned rear garden surrounded by mature trees, established hedgerows, and a greenhouse, offering an exceptionally private and peaceful outdoor space.

Agents Note - A structural report has taken place and further works have been recommend – a report is available upon request.

They are as follows:

Underpinning of the gable wall foundations;
Installation of underground surface water drainage along the gable wall;
Replacement rainwater goods to improve water discharge; and
Installation of steel ties between the gable wall and return wall.
